What does a green arrow indicate?

Explanation:
A green arrow is a traffic signal that means it is safe to proceed in the direction the arrow points. This indicates that drivers have the right of way and can move forward without needing to stop for oncoming traffic or other obstacles that would typically require yielding. The green arrow typically accompanies a red light for other lanes of traffic, which reinforces the safety of proceeding in that specific direction. Understanding this signal is crucial for safe driving, as it helps manage traffic flow and reduce the risk of accidents at intersections.
